Artifact signing — TripGate breaker service. All breaker config bundles for the Norrow upstream API must be signed before the rollout daemon accepts them. Unsigned bundles are dropped silently — check the daemon log if a config change never lands. Sign with the team key, not your personal one. Rotation happens quarterly; on-call owns the swap. Verify the fingerprint against the wiki header after any rotation. Current signing key for breaker bundles follows.

signing key of baduf-taweg = bky6_Zf7bem

## Runbook: Gaugepile Sidecar — Release Checklist

Heads up: the sidecar ships with every app pod, so a bad config fans out fast. Before cutting a release, confirm the flush interval hasn't drifted from what the Tallyhouse aggregator expects, or you'll see sawtooth gaps in dashboards. Rollbacks are cheap — just repin the image tag. Canary one node pool first, watch for ten minutes, then proceed. The values to verify against are these.

config for bagep-yafof:
quenath:
  pin: 8584
  metrics_host: metrics.quenath.tolvaqsys.internal
  tenant: pelath
  seal: seal_ed102645

## Rebalancing Runs

Pedalgrid's rebalancer evaluates dock occupancy every 20 minutes and emits move orders that plugins may filter or reorder. Plugins must return within 5 seconds or their output is skipped for that cycle. Orders flagged `locked` by the core engine cannot be altered. Scoring weights, plugin lifecycle hooks, and sandbox setup instructions are documented on the internal page.

operations page: https://jenkins.zemvarcloud.local/job/merge_requests/repo/build/73930b4b30f0a8ed

## Artifact Signing — StreamWeave Transport Builds

StreamWeave's websocket layer ships two compression profiles: permessage-deflate for low-traffic tenants and the lighter frame-level codec for chatty feeds. Reviewers should confirm that any change to the negotiation table is reflected in both artifact variants, since they're built and signed separately. Mixing a new codec table with an old-signed peer artifact causes handshake drift. Both artifacts must carry a valid signature before promotion to staging. Sign with the current release key:

deploy key for yajop-fahop: bky3_h1v